Troubleshooting Common Pool Chlorinator Issues

Pool chlorinators, whether they're salt cells or chemical feeders , can sometimes have problems. Typical issues include low chlorine levels , inconsistent operation, or a complete malfunction. Let's examine some of the usual causes and how to address them. Firstly, with salt systems , inspect the salt content - too little or too much can affect performance. A scaled cell is another frequent culprit; regular cleaning with a appropriate solution is vital. For chemical dispensers , ensure the wafer is properly positioned and ample to last the website designated cycle. Finally, double-check the energy supply and adjustments are correct; a easy reset often resolves minor glitches .

Saltwater vs. Chlorine: Which Pool Chlorinator is Best?

Choosing between a salt system pool and a traditional chlorine system can be a challenging choice for pool owners. Saltwater systems utilize a device that converts sodium chloride into sanitizer, offering a even level of cleaning and often perceived as softer on body. However, they require a higher upfront investment and periodic upkeep. Alternatively, chlorine systems with liquid are typically less expensive to begin and manage, but can require more frequent corrections to water readings and may lead to irritation for some bathers.
